隨著全球經濟進入生產過程和中間產品貿易分散為特點的「全球價值鏈」(Global Value Chain, GVC)時代,近年來許多學者主要探究全球重要經濟體整體產業的 GVC 地 位,顯少針對一國主要出口國家進行國與國之間特定產業的 GVC 地位衡量。本文利用 2000-2014 年世界投入產出表(WIOD)數據與對外經濟貿易大學(UIBE)之 GVC 指數 測算台灣、美國、中國電子科技相關產業的 GVC 地位,並利用 Feng(2020)提出之雙 重結構分解法(SDA)分析影響台灣、美國、中國 GVC 地位差異的因素。結果顯示: 台灣與美國的電子科技相關產業同時處於上下游產業端,但台灣 GVC 地位較不穩定, 主要受國際中間產品投入我國的比例與國內其他產業 GVC 地位差異所影響,因此需提 升我國其他與電子科技相關產業有前向聯繫效應之產業的 GVC 地位。
As the global industries started to disperse the process of manufacturing to other countries. In recent years, many scholars mainly explored the Global Value Chain positions, but rarely measure the GVC positions of one country and major export countries. Using data of World Input and Output and GVC Indicators of UIBE to measure the electric technological related industries' GVC positions of Taiwan, The U.S., and China, and analyzes the factors affecting the difference of GVC positions via structural decomposition method (SDA) by Feng (2020). The result shows that the electronic technological related industries of Taiwan and The U.S. are in the upstream and downstream industries. However, Taiwan's GVC positions are unstable and usually affect by GVC positions differences in domestic industries and the intermediate goods input from foreign countries. Thus, improving the GVC positions of Taiwan's other electronic technological-related industries which have a forward linkage effect is needed.
